TEMAS (Technology And Mind Association)
As team members of Freshness were in Tokyo, they were fortunate to stop by this rare shop, simply known as TEMAS. Hidden away in Tokyo’s trendy neighborhood of Aoyama, TEMAS is renown all over Japan for its specialty: black dye. The brand focuse in using an ancient Japanese black pigment dying technique, a secret process passed-on by respected Kyoto craftsmen since the Hei-An Era (794 AD – 1185 AD), some 1,000 years ago, when the city of Kyoto was still the capital of Japan.

TEMAS has been producing numerous items, ranging from accessories to common ready-to-wear, available in all styles and for all occasions. As you can see, all their items are in black, the company’s specialty, with some slight accented colors.
Items seen here are just a few from TEMAS‘ collections. TEMAS also has 2 sister labels: YF, a collaboration label between TEMAS and Yasushi Fujimoto, an art director, whom worked with numerous Japanese fashion magazines, such as Vogue Japan, Ginza, Brutus, and etc. ..
The second label, also under the direction of Mr. Fujimoto, is simply known as #000000. This label experiments in the production of a so-called “neo-black” colored textile. This label recently released, what it called “Black Camo”, a colorway created by the combination of several different black pigments in a certain procedure that the end results resemble a camouflage pattern, in all black.

As previously mentioned, 32 teams will pit against each other on Saturday’s 3rd season of PUMA Table Tennis Tournament (PT3). Winners and runner-ups will walk away with more than just bragging rights. Each will be the first to receive this limited edition paddle and balls by NY-based creative agency, aruliden.
Envisioned specifically for PT3 by co-founder of aruliden, Johan Liden. This paddle and balls set, named ULTRAMAGNETIC COLLECTION, is like no other. Instead of being fabric based, the enclosure on ULTRAMAGNETIC COLLECTION is made of durable ABS plastic, similar to those found in bike helmets. A thin layer of foam lined the interior, to cushion the contents. Another unique aspect is how the user access his/her gears. There are no zipper of Velcro fasteners. Instead, aruliden affixed series of magnets within the ABS plastic. This allows the players to open the case in multitude of ways, without any hinge to hamper their access. The ULTRAMAGNETIC COLLECTION will be available in 2 colorways: black and white. More information on availability to come.

Nike AF 1 – Tokyo Celebration
Freshness was invited to the recent Nike AF 1 25th Anniversary Celebration, this at Tokyo’s 1LOVE store opening. The store, with the sole purpose of Nike Air Force 1 in mind, opened late last month, January 25th, saw guests from all over the globe. Each get to enjoyed the Nike experience as a whole, from customizing at a NIKEiD Studio on the top level, to a gallery-like AF 1 & AF 25 only shop on the lower level. A must-see for visitors is the interior display, with 200 white AF 1′s on a glass wall inspired by the pivot-sole – a take on retro sci-fi movie’s teleportation dock.
Rumors of the store opening had a tsunami of anticipated spectators gushing through the store front to take glimpse inside. Nike has created another milestone in Japan’s ever popular street culture scene. The 1LOVE store will operate for 1 year only. Photos by AKI.

Heyday Footwear combines the authentic look and construction of wedge soled work boots with athletic influences, leather linings, triple stitching, and Heyday’s unique setback raw leather edges. The raw leather edges will add character through normal wear making your pair even more individual. Darin Hager, the Chief Heymaker of Heyday Footwear, has been designing shoes for 10 years.
Working for such diverse brands as PUMA, Sperry Top-Sider, and DKNY Active as well as running his very successful footwear design consulting firm, Hager Design. It was just a matter of time before he put all of his connections together to create his own line. Honestly it’s a breath of fresh air to see something original and not just an Air Force One sillouette. The target consumers are guys creative guys into the sneaker scene but who desire more original product than is currently seen at most retail stores. The final sales samples have arrived just in time for the POOL trade show where Darin will be debuting the line.
